In our world, we are surrounded by people who are different than us. Whether it is by their cutlure, nature, hair color, or ethnicity. Our world is full of unique people and cultures, yet most of the time we do not truly understand those who are different than us.

The United States claims to be a nation that welcomes all cultures and is a melting pot for culture and diversity, yet when most people encounter a religion or culture they do not understand, they fear it or reject it. Part of this is from the media, which feeds us false information and single stories of other cultures. And part of it, is the ignorance of the Western world.

But that is changing. Now companies, like Coca-cola, and social media platforms are using their power to help educate people, that in a world full of differences, we are all human.

In this campaign Coca-Cola challenges us to remove the label. Take a look and think about the last time you judged someone simply by how they look.


To summarize, Coca-Cola puts six strangers in a room together in complete darkness and has them talk about themselves and to each other. They cannot see each other, but only hear what the others have to say. Then at the end the lights come on, and the strangers are shocked. They had a vision in their mind of what someone was supposed to look like based on their accomplishments and lifestyle -- so when they are revealed as something different they cannot believe it.

The biggest take away from this is that many of the strangers say how they would have probably shied away from that person if they saw them on the street or come to conclusions about their lifestyle simply by how they appeared. They would have labelled them.

It is the culture that we live in to label people and come to conclusions about people before we even get to know them.
